Q: Is 3,530,256 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,530,256 is a composite number.

Why is 3,530,256 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,530,256 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 16 24 48 73,547 147,094 220,641 294,188 441,282 588,376 882,564 1,176,752 1,765,128 and 3,530,256, with no remainder.

Since 3,530,256 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,530,256, it is a composite number.
